16th August to 18th August 2007
Summer Breeze Open Air - Day 1: BRESCHDLENG, JUSTICE, LACRIMAS PROFUNDERE, AFTER FOREVER, DORO, NEVERMORE, TANZWUT, AMON AMARTH, DORNENREICH
This August, the Summer Breeze Open Air in the south of Germany, a festival well-known to all the Metal fans out there, still by far not as big as Wacken for example, but rather nice and straightforward, has celebrated its 10th anniversary. For the second year now it took place on a small airfield near the village of Dinkelsbühl. The journey there without any car was pretty hard, but we rejoiced in not being controlled like the drivers. Every car had to queue up and the securities did check them all. Only every sixth group of walkers was controlled on weapons and glass.

24th to 26th August 2007
Area4 Festival Day 1: Leo Can Dive, The Datsuns, Donots, Soulfly, The (International) Noise Conspiracy, Eagles of Death Metal, NoFX
Promoters of Area4 festival seem to have a good connection to the weather god. After unbelievably bad, cold and rainy August, the first festival day welcomed us really with sun! Best conditions for the three days of festival fun at the airfield Borkenberge. The venue was perfectly situated lonely and far away from any residents who could moan about the noise. The festival was organised really well to welcome all the visitors - a nice venue, good camping and parking conditions and short ways included.

Flugplatz Drispenstedt, Hildesheim, Germany
11th to 12th August 2007
M’era Luna Festival Day 2 - Hangar Stage: Proceed, Implant, Angels & Agony, Diorama, Rabia Sorda, 32Crash, Welle:Erdball, IAMX, Anne Clark
While the bands on the main stage were performing in bright sunlight, you could enjoy the shadow in the Hangar when mostly electronic bands were playing there. Well-known names like DIORAMA, WELLE:ERDBALL, IAMX or ANNE CLARK were drawing people inside. But also some smaller or new projects like 32CRASH, RABIA SORDA, ANGELS & AGONY, IMPLANT and PROCEED deserved the attention of the visitors.
